Following the release of the first single “Blood Honey” from their album Odyssey to Room 101 Quasarborn have just released their second single and music video for the title track. The new album is due for release on May 18th and was recorded, mixed, mastered and produced by Luka Matković in Citadela studio, Belgrade.
As the title suggests, the title track from our debut album is heavily influenced by both George Orwell’s 1984 and Aldous Huxley’s Brave New World. It represents the final chapter in the album’s storyline, portraying the dreadful final hours of the protagonist in which he is tortured, and stripped of every last bit of humanity, dignity and identity – a fate worse, or equal to death.
“The Odyssey to Room 101” is the longest song on the record, but is also probably the most versatile, and dynamic. It is intense, powerful, angry, and yet melodic and structured at the same time. It really sums up the essence of the band up until this point.
